Тема: WPF + MVVM
Доброго дня!
Дивлюся фреймворк Catel.
Я на правильному шляху? Чи може товариство порадить інші?
Дякую.
Гарного вечора.
Ви не увійшли. Будь ласка, увійдіть або зареєструйтесь.
Ласкаво просимо вас на україномовний форум з програмування, веб-дизайну, SEO та всього пов'язаного з інтернетом та комп'ютерами.
Будемо вдячні, якщо ви поділитись посиланням на Replace.org.ua на інших ресурсах.
Для того щоб створювати теми та надсилати повідомлення вам потрібно Зареєструватись.
Український форум програмістів → C#, .NET → WPF + MVVM
Сторінки 1
Для відправлення відповіді ви повинні увійти або зареєструватися
Доброго дня!
Дивлюся фреймворк Catel.
Я на правильному шляху? Чи може товариство порадить інші?
Дякую.
Гарного вечора.
Доброго дня!
пишу проект WPF + MVVM без сторонніх фреймворків.
Питання.
У вікно(view) зчитую (передається параметром viewmodel ) список продуктів.
у вікні дана можливість вказати по назві продукта що шукати.
Після натиснення кнопки викликається метод із viewmodel який виконує пошук.
при дебагу у viewmodel результат пошуку правильний.
Результати у вікні не обновляються.
Як правильно задати біндінг в даному випадку?
Зараз в мене вказано так:
... ItemsSource="{Binding Wares, Mode=TwoWay, IsAsync=True}" ...
in XAML for DataGrid
... ItemsSource="{Binding Wares, UpdateSourceTrigger=PropertyChanged, Mode=TwoWay}"...
in ViewModel
var queryWare = db.Wares.Where(w => w.Name.Contains(searchString));
Wares = new ObservableCollection<Ware>(queryWare);
OnPropertyChanged(nameof(Wares));
Сторінки 1
Для відправлення відповіді ви повинні увійти або зареєструватися